[QUOTE="HardRightEdge, post: 496177"] 1st. round would be a shock. 2nd. round would be a surprise. 3rd. round is in the range of reasonable expectations. 4th. round on down is the more likely scenario. I think we'd be more likely to go high for a TE than a WR. If Finley sucks in 2013 we'll let him go. If he plays anywhere between decent and great he'll take the most $ the market will bear, and that will not likely be our offer. Re-signing Jones should be manageable. His chances of scoring that frequently again are about nil. I don't think there's much he can do to change the view that he'd be just an OK #2 and a very good #3. That's not a bank breaker. [/QUOTE]
